About sixty to seventy people came to the meetup. This is probably the biggest meetup we ever had.
There were two regular talks:
- Luka Vladika, End-to-End Testing Redefined: The Testa Platform
- Dinko Vranjicic, Load testing 101
Luka talked about Testa, their internal testing tool. I was hoping it would be an open source tool, or at least commercial, so I could take a closer look. It looked really interesting. As far as I understood it, it’s a low-code tool that they use for web and mobile test automation. Everything is in the cloud. The only thing needed on your machine is a web browser.
Dinko gave an overview of load testing. He also talked about a tool they use for load testing k6. From what I saw, it’s something I would consider using if I needed to do load testing.
Both talks were in English since some people didn’t understand Croatian. Both talks were good and there was a lot of discussion after each talk.
